7. Imagine a safe place

Whenever you start feeling anxious, find a safe, quiet, and comfortable space where you can focus. Sometimes, being able to visualize yourself in different surroundings can help the mind and body relax and calm down.

Think of the most ideal place to relax—a meadow, your childhood bedroom, a cozy library or even a quiet coffee shop. It can be any place in the world, but make sure the image you are imagining is one that makes you feel happy, safe, and peaceful. You can even add layers to it by imaging how it would sound like if you were there, the smells, and even how objects in that place would feel.

Always remember this safe place whenever you feel like your current surroundings get too overwhelming.
